Our Mission

The Hartford Professional Chapter partnership with EWB-USA was founded in November, 2006, with the following goals:

  • To help disadvantaged communities throughout the world meet their basic needs through Professional Chapter projects.

  • To have the Professional Members be a technical resource for students of all levels.

  • To collect and provide research on sustainable technologies to create internationally responsible engineers.

  • To maintain a presence in the local community through service.

This type of partnership of professional engineers, engineering students, and head office resources results in environmentally and economically sustainable projects that are compatible with the environment, society and culture of the community, and globally-minded responsible engineers.
